Are You Getting Enough Sleep?

Not just now during this very busy season, but all throughout the year?  So many times, getting enough sleep surfaces as a critical success factor for reaching and maintaining a healthy weight.  I know this is an ongoing challenge with my healthy journey.  My sleep patterns are all &$#+ed up.  This week was a particularly notable week of bad sleep due to an unbelievably busy week at work.  My mind simply doesn't shut off for long enough.  I fall asleep easily and well.  But I tend to wake up 4-5 hours later and finish the night with tossing and turning. After 4 nights of sleep deprivation, it is harder to function well.  It is enough to drive me crazy.  There is no doubt in my mind that the added stress of sleep deprivation impedes my ability to easily shed weight.

I have tried everything short of sleep drugs.  I just can't bring myself to do drugs.  Restorative yoga, herbal teas, warm relaxing baths, reading, no TV in the bedroom (never had on in the bedroom, don't believe in it), light dinner, avoid caffeine, no sugar near bedtime, going to bed and waking up at a similar time each day and so much more.
